The Magical Destroyers original TV anime was created by designer JUN INAGAWA with Hiroshi Ikehata (FLCL Progressive) directing the series at Bibury Animation Studios. The series premiered today and is now streaming on Crunchyroll, which describes it like so:

 

Freedom of expression is threatened when a mysterious group, the SSC, destroy Japan’s otaku culture. However, a young revolutionary, Otaku Hero—who loves the culture more than anything—rises up. With the help of three rambunctious magical girls—Anarchy, Blue, and Pink—they’ll team up to create a world free of this oppressive rule. Be part of the rebellion to bring back fandom!
